纽西兰核准糖尿病患移植猪细胞NZ OKs pig-human tissue transplants for diabetics

NZ OKs pig-human tissue transplants for diabetics

New Zealand recently gave the green light for clinical trials involving the transplantation of pig cells into humans in a potential breakthrough treatment of diabetes.

Health Minister David Cunliffe said the process had huge potential for diabetes sufferers.

Biotech entrepreneur Living Cell Technologies Ltd (LCT) wants to transfer cells from the pancreas of pigs to produce insulin in type-1 diabetes sufferers.

Though the technology could produce significant benefits for patients, it is highly controversial given the potential for a pig virus to be transferred to humans.

The New Zealand Medical Association (NZMA) warned in 2005 that a deadly virus transmission through this pathway could potentially kill millions of people.

When the current application for a clinical trial in New Zealand was made, a Wellington think tank urged the minister to consult the public on the "community risk" in the event that transplanted pig tissues triggered an infectious disease in humans.

LCT has said it can limit risks by using tissues from piglets in a breeding line said to have been isolated from other pigs for over 150 years on the Auckland Islands.

According to LCT, a group of Russians injected with New Zealand pig cells last year showed reductions in daily insulin requirements ranging from 23 percent to as much as 100 percent, and had good control of blood glucose levels in four out of five patients.

    • transplant  (n.)   移植
      The doctor said that the patient's only hope was a heart transplant.

    • potential  (adj.)   可能的;有潛力的
      Ads promising a potential income of a million dollars should probably not be trusted.

    • entrepreneur  (n.)   企業家;主辦人
      The young entrepreneur tried to start an umbrella business, but it failed because it never rained.

    • insulin  (n.)   胰島素
      The bodies of people with diabetes do not produce enough insulin.

    • controversial  (adj.)   引起爭議或爭論的
      The political candidate tried to avoid speaking about controversial issues.

    • transmission  (n.)   傳送;傳播
      The Carl Sagan novel Contact is about a woman astronomer who receives a transmission from space.

    • to inject  (v.)   注射;注入
      Young children should be injected with the measles vaccine.

    • to give the green light   核准;批准
      The authorities gave the green light for construction of the new highway.

    • community risk   公共風險;社區危險
      Because the vicious dog was considered a community risk, its owners were forced to get rid of it.

    • breeding line   品種;品系
      The beautiful Arabian horse came from a long breeding line of racehorses.
